package com.google.javascript.jscomp;
import com.google.common.base.Joiner;
import com.google.common.collect.ImmutableList;
import java.io.Serializable;
import java.util.ArrayList;
import java.util.Collections;
import java.util.Comparator;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import java.util.TreeSet;
/**
* WarningsGuard that represents just a chain of other guards. For example we
* could have following chain
* 1) all warnings outside of /foo/ should be suppressed
* 2) errors with key JSC_BAR should be marked as warning
* 3) the rest should be reported as error
*
* This class is designed for such behavior.
*
* @author anatol@google.com (Anatol Pomazau)
*/
public class ComposeWarningsGuard extends WarningsGuard {
private static final long serialVersionUID = 1L;
// The order that the guards were added in.
private final Map<WarningsGuard, Integer> orderOfAddition = new HashMap<>();
private int numberOfAdds = 0;
private final Comparator<WarningsGuard> guardComparator =
new GuardComparator(orderOfAddition);
private boolean demoteErrors = false;
private static class GuardComparator
implements Comparator<WarningsGuard>, Serializable {
private static final long serialVersionUID = 1L;
private final Map<WarningsGuard, Integer> orderOfAddition;
private GuardComparator(Map<WarningsGuard, Integer> orderOfAddition) {
this.orderOfAddition = orderOfAddition;
}
@Override
public int compare(WarningsGuard a, WarningsGuard b) {
int priorityDiff = a.getPriority() - b.getPriority();
if (priorityDiff != 0) {
return priorityDiff;
}
// If the warnings guards have the same priority, the one that
// was added last wins.
return orderOfAddition.get(b).intValue() - orderOfAddition.get(a).intValue();
}
}
// The order that the guards are applied in.
private final TreeSet<WarningsGuard> guards =
new TreeSet<>(guardComparator);
public ComposeWarningsGuard(List<WarningsGuard> guards) {
addGuards(guards);
}
public ComposeWarningsGuard(WarningsGuard... guards) {
this(ImmutableList.copyOf(guards));
}
void addGuard(WarningsGuard guard) {
if (guard instanceof ComposeWarningsGuard) {
ComposeWarningsGuard composeGuard = (ComposeWarningsGuard) guard;
if (composeGuard.demoteErrors) {
this.demoteErrors = composeGuard.demoteErrors;
}
// Reverse the guards, so that they have the same order in the result.
addGuards(new ArrayList<>(composeGuard.guards.descendingSet()));
} else {
numberOfAdds++;
orderOfAddition.put(guard, numberOfAdds);
guards.remove(guard);
guards.add(guard);
}
}
private void addGuards(Iterable<WarningsGuard> guards) {
for (WarningsGuard guard : guards) {
addGuard(guard);
}
}
@Override
public CheckLevel level(JSError error) {
for (WarningsGuard guard : guards) {
CheckLevel newLevel = guard.level(error);
if (newLevel != null) {
if (demoteErrors && newLevel == CheckLevel.ERROR) {
return CheckLevel.WARNING;
}
return newLevel;
}
}
return null;
}
@Override
public boolean disables(DiagnosticGroup group) {
nextSingleton:
for (DiagnosticType type : group.getTypes()) {
DiagnosticGroup singleton = DiagnosticGroup.forType(type);
for (WarningsGuard guard : guards) {
if (guard.disables(singleton)) {
continue nextSingleton;
} else if (guard.enables(singleton)) {
return false;
}
}
return false;
}
return true;
}
/**
* Determines whether this guard will "elevate" the status of any disabled
* diagnostic type in the group to a warning or an error.
*/
@Override
public boolean enables(DiagnosticGroup group) {
for (WarningsGuard guard : guards) {
if (guard.enables(group)) {
return true;
} else if (guard.disables(group)) {
return false;
}
}
return false;
}
@Override
public DiagnosticGroupState enablesExplicitly(DiagnosticGroup group) {
for (WarningsGuard guard : guards) {
switch (guard.enablesExplicitly(group)) {
case ON:
return DiagnosticGroupState.ON;
case OFF:
return DiagnosticGroupState.OFF;
case UNSPECIFIED:
continue;
}
}
return DiagnosticGroupState.UNSPECIFIED;
}
List<WarningsGuard> getGuards() {
return Collections.unmodifiableList(new ArrayList<>(guards));
}
/**
* Make a warnings guard that's the same as this one but demotes all
* errors to warnings.
*/
ComposeWarningsGuard makeEmergencyFailSafeGuard() {
ComposeWarningsGuard safeGuard = new ComposeWarningsGuard();
safeGuard.demoteErrors = true;
for (WarningsGuard guard : guards.descendingSet()) {
safeGuard.addGuard(guard);
}
return safeGuard;
}
@Override
protected ComposeWarningsGuard makeNonStrict() {
ComposeWarningsGuard nonStrictGuard = new ComposeWarningsGuard();
for (WarningsGuard guard : guards.descendingSet()) {
if (!(guard instanceof StrictWarningsGuard)) {
nonStrictGuard.addGuard(guard.makeNonStrict());
}
}
return nonStrictGuard;
}
@Override
public String toString() {
return Joiner.on(", ").join(guards);
}
}
